About this listen

As a parlor maid, Blanche Eplett is invisible to everyone in her life…except for Ludwig Turner, the rakishly handsome master of the house. When Ludwig’s interest in Blanche becomes something more amorous, she finds herself pregnant with his child and soon gives birth to a little girl named May. At first, Ludwig is there to care for them both. But when tragedy strikes, Blanche and May are thrown out onto the streets.

Blanche will do anything to care for May and to protect the child’s kind and loving heart—a heart that is soon enamored by a fellow street urchin named Taylor Harris. But as poverty continues to govern their world, May and Taylor are torn apart. For both of them, life becomes empty without the other. In the poverty-thick streets of London, how will they ever find each other again? For years, May stubbornly clings to hope, praying that her faith will be rewarded.
